2021 ICD-10-CM Diagnosis Code F13.2
2021 ICD-10-CM Diagnosis Code F13.2
Sedative, hypnotic or anxiolytic-related dependence
2016 2017 2018 2019 2020 2021 Non-Billable/Non-Specific Code
- F13.2 should not be used for reimbursement purposes as there are multiple codes below it that contain a greater level of detail.
- The 2021 edition of ICD-10-CM F13.2 became effective on October 1, 2020.
- This is the American ICD-10-CM version of F13.2 - other international versions of ICD-10 F13.2 may differ.
Type 1 ExcludesType 1 Excludes Help
A type 1 excludes note is a pure excludes. It means "not coded here". A type 1 excludes note indicates that the code excluded should never be used at the same time as F13.2. A type 1 excludes note is for used for when two conditions cannot occur together, such as a congenital form versus an acquired form of the same condition.
Type 2 ExcludesType 2 Excludes Help
A type 2 excludes note represents "not included here". A type 2 excludes note indicates that the condition excluded is not part of the condition it is excluded from but a patient may have both conditions at the same time. When a type 2 excludes note appears under a code it is acceptable to use both the code (F13.2) and the excluded code together.
